1996 LE Roadsport

K Series 1400 Supersport

BRG with Yellow Nose Band and Stripe

6 Speed

16,190 Miles

Painted Carbon front cycle wings

Painted roll bar

Carbon rear wing protectors

14" Minilite Alloys with Anthracite painted centres with Yokohama 021r's fitted

260mm Momo Leather Steering Wheel

Black Leather S Type Seats

Black Carpeted interior

Heated Screen

Weather Gear

Hood Bag

Vecta Immobiliser

Map pocket

Wind Deflectors

Se7en related Reg

MOT and Tax till May '09

Kit built so vis smoke test only although fitted & MOT'd with Cat exhaust

Cambelt changed June '06

New rear tyres less than 1000 miles ago

One previous owner from new

 

Excellent overall condition, excepting some gravel rash on the rear wings.

 

O.I.R.O £10,500

 

Sale due to lack of use (only 1180miles covered during my ownership) and possible upcoming foray into the world of Motorsport which this car is far too nice for.
